BTS 'Arirang' Ascends to the Summit of Billboard 200

In a remarkable display of their global influence and musical prowess, BTS has achieved a monumental milestone as their latest work, 'Arirang,' ascends to the pinnacle of the Billboard 200 chart. This achievement is part of a larger wave of success that sees the group dominating international music charts and selling out concert venues worldwide.

With the release of their fifth studio album 'Arirang,' BTS has captured the attention of music enthusiasts both domestically and on the international stage. The album's sweeping success is evident as it climbs to the top of critical weekly music charts, solidifying BTS's position as a formidable force in the music industry.

Insights from the 30th of the month reveal that according to Hanteo Chart, a prominent album sales tracking platform, BTS's 'Arirang' claimed the number one spot on the weekly world and album charts. This accolade was achieved just three days following its release on March 20, during the third week of March. The album's sustained popularity is further evidenced by its ability to maintain its position for two consecutive weeks.

An informative article released by the American music publication Billboard on the 30th highlights the extraordinary achievement of 'Arirang' reaching the apex of the 'Billboard 200' album chart for the week dated April 4. The album made an impressive debut with the entry of 641,000 album units, marking it as the most successful group album launch since the commencement of unit tracking in December 2014. Notably, 532,000 of these were credited to pure album sales, encompassing both physical and digital formats, setting a new benchmark for the highest weekly sales for a group album in more than a decade.

BTS's influence extends beyond the Billboard charts as they assert their dominance on global music platforms. The ensemble has taken over the weekly charts of Spotify, a leading global audio and music streaming service, during the tracking period from March 20 to 26. They achieved top positions in categories such as 'Weekly Top Albums,' 'Weekly Top Songs,' and 'Weekly Top Artists' on a global scale. The album's title track, 'SWIM,' garnered particular attention, securing the number one position on the 'Weekly Top Songs Global' chart, with all 14 tracks from the album finding a place within the top 30.

'SWIM' further demonstrated its appeal by consistently leading Spotify's 'Daily Top Songs Global' and Apple Music's 'Top 100 Global' for extended periods of 9 days (from March 20 to 28) and 7 days (from March 23 to 29), respectively. The sustained presence of all album tracks on these platforms' latest chart rankings, even ten days post-release, underscores the album's widespread resonance and the enduring support from their global fanbase.


 

In light of their album's success, BTS is set to embark on the 'BTS WORLD TOUR 'ARIRANG'', with performances scheduled at the Goyang Sports Complex Main Stadium in Goyang, Gyeonggi Province, on April 9, 11, and 12. Their tour will further extend to encompass stadium shows across South America in October, visiting countries such as Colombia, Peru, Argentina, Chile, and Brazil. Notably, all 46 performances, including those in Goyang, North America, Europe, and Tokyo, Japan, have already sold out, reflecting the immense demand for their live shows and the powerful draw of their musical artistry.
